| What do people typically do in a session? |
| |
My
intent for a first session is to give a person at least a taste of
Focusing. Because we all come to Focusing from such different places,
what shape this takes is hard to predict. What I do is easier to talk
about: I guide the person step by step through the Focusing process.
This means that I help you bring your awareness into your body and
greet what you find there. From that point on, we follow the needs and
desires of the "somethings" that you find in your inner world, with an
attitude of compassion and acceptance. For example, if something inside
wants to let you know how it feels, we will listen together and let it
know that you hear it. If something inside is afraid, we will keep that
part company and invite it to tell us about its fear. If something
inside wants to hide, we will let it know that it's okay to hide ...
that we will not force it to do anything it doesn't want to do. And so
on ...
Focusing
is about deeply listening to your inner world. When you listen to
yourself this way, you create a new relationship with yourself. My job
as a guide is to coach people in this tender approach to their own
inner relationship. |

| How will I feel after a session? |
| You
are likely to feel some difference in the issue you worked on after
just one session. Many people experience a significant shift. Some
people find they feel better without knowing why – at least at first.
“I don’t know why I feel so light and relaxed; the problem is the
same.” Wait a few hours... let the process unfold... and then check
again if the problem or issue feels different. Sometimes
people want more sessions, others may want to practice further on their
own and others may feel ready for a Level 1 workshop at this point. Although
many people want only one or two sessions, I am also available to work
with people over a number of sessions. This is completely your choice. |
